Canada seeks to resolve canola tariffs with China through high-level visits and talks.
Liberal MP Kody Blois says Canada expects more high-level visits to China as Ottawa works to resolve a trade dispute over canola tariffs.
Blois, parliamentary secretary to Prime Minister Mark Carney, joined Saskatchewan Premier Scott Moe on a recent trip to China to urge Beijing to lift tariffs on Canadian canola, imposed after Canada matched U.S. tariffs on Chinese electric vehicles.
The visit included meetings with Chinese officials from trade, foreign affairs, and customs departments, which Blois described as positive and a chance for re-engagement.
He anticipates further dialogue and increased federal ministerial visits to address trade tensions and support Canada’s $4.9 billion canola export market.
